## Changelog — Quexly 2.0 (for weekly eng sync)

As part of retiring the homegrown job queue in favor of Quexly, the setting formerly called `HJQ_WORKER_TOKEN_PATH` has been renamed to `QUEXLY_BROKER_AUTH`. The old name is honored until the 2.2 cutoff, after which workers will refuse to start. Migration: update `worker.env`, keep concurrency values unchanged, and verify the dead-letter topic exists before rollout. Directly beneath the renamed key, the broker credential itself is set on the next line.

env line for baduf-hahog: RELAY_SECRET3=c4a

# Cold start notes for on-call (Quillbrook functions platform)
# Serverless handlers in the exports stack can take 4-6 seconds on a cold start
# because the Fernwald runtime loads the full schema registry at init.
# If latency alerts fire overnight, check whether the keep-warm pinger in the
# Oakhollow region is running before paging anyone else.
# Do not lower the memory tier; it makes cold starts worse.
# The pinger authenticates against the platform with a credential set in this
# file, directly below this comment block.

vault entry, yahif-yajep: COURIER_KEY29=b802bdf8034096b65a51c6ba5abe2

# Pellet Cache: Bloom Filter Limits

The bloom filter fronting the Pellet key-value store absorbs lookups for absent keys before they hit disk. Its size and hash count are fixed at startup; resizing requires a full rebuild, which blocks writes for several minutes on large shards. Releases that change key cardinality estimates must re-derive these values, or false-positive rates climb and disk reads spike. The limits currently enforced per shard are listed below.

limits module of fajog-tawig:
RATE_LIMITS = {
    "druwyn": 2,
    "quenael": 10,
    "wenix": 2,
    "druael": 2,
}

### Runbook: BounceBroom — Account Recovery

If the BounceBroom email bounce processor loses access to its service account, do not create a new one. First, pause the intake queue so bounces buffer safely. Then open the recovery console and select the BounceBroom principal. Verification requires approval from the on-call lead. Once approved, the console prompts for the stored recovery credentials; enter the passphrase that appears directly below this paragraph.

recovery phrase for fahof-kahap: holion-gormir-jorix-istix-briwyn-sorael